Strolling down H Street in northeast DC, you might pass an unassuming brick row house behind which resides a quirky art gallery. It was also the site of Katy and Alex’ Gallery O on H wedding. A charming urban oasis, the venue includes both indoor and outdoor event spaces and a multi-level courtyard. It made for a stunning wedding last summer!

The summery, urban garden vibe started with a bold floral palette in shades of coral and peach, bright yellows, and lush greens. Katy’s bouquet featured the most stunning Coral expression garden roses, apricot lisianthus, fresh picked trumpet vine, yellow butterfly ranunculus, solidago and a blush of Cafe au Lait dahlia finished with a dramatic cascade of jasmine. The groom’s boutonniere completed the bride’s bouquet, with petite yellow spray roses on his lapel.

Lush smilax foliage cemented the urban garden vibe, the delicious tendrils of greenery rimming the top edge and cascading naturally down the sides and accented with blooms in romantic corals, yellows, and peaches. Surrounded by the venues potted plants, it really conveyed an enchanted feel. Flowers in wedding colors graced the sign at the entrance to the aisle.

The Gallery O on H wedding reception transformed the outdoor courtyard space, with long farm tables placed along the length of the brick-lined alley. Each of the tables featured a lush garland-style tablescape of greenery and blooms was finished with lanterns and copper mercury glass votives.

The event was magically captured by photographer Erika Layne, including two of our favorites – the couple on the staircase we decorated with smilax and twinkle lights, and the couple in a private moment just seen through the upstairs gallery window. Industrial spaces have a beauty of their own, but the right floral design can take them from warehouse to urban garden. 🌿✨ 

For Laura & Michael’s Dock 5 wedding, we played with scale—tall magnolia branches to emphasize the height, lush florals to soften the space, and candlelight to add warmth. The result? An urban oasis that felt both grand and intimate.

1️⃣Go Big with Greenery – Tall magnolia branches brought height and movement to Laura & Michael’s Dock 5 wedding

2️⃣ Mix Textures – Lush, low floral arrangements softened the industrial edges while keeping the space dynamic

3️⃣ Layer Candlelight – Warm glows + metal details = a romantic urban oasis

4️⃣ Frame Key Spaces – A floral garland on the head table grounded the design and added intimacy. Trees flanking the table took it to the next level 

5️⃣ Contrast is Key – Pairing the raw, industrial elements with soft florals and organic details created the perfect balance
